Arnel Posted February 26, 2013 Share Posted February 26, 2013 Hello Spiritmedia! If you haven't already found the solution to this, the item you're trying to remove is actually part of the Module interface that Prestashop gives you access to. It doesn't give you an option to change that text, but you CAN remove it. You need to go to the MODULES section of PrestaShop Dashboard and search for CMS block configuration Click on Configure Look in the Footer section and you'll see the checkbox for "powered by" - you can uncheck this.
